Cybersecurity Checklist for Small & Medium Businesses (SMEs)
A Simple, Practical Guide to Protect Your Business
Cybersecurity can feel overwhelming—but it doesn’t have to be.
The reality is this: most cyberattacks succeed because of basic gaps, not sophisticated hacking.
This checklist gives you a simple, actionable starting point to protect your business today.
1. Lock Down Your Logins

✔ Use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A) on all accounts
✔ Avoid reusing passwords across systems
✔ Use a password manager (don’t store passwords in browsers or spreadsheets)
Why it matters:
Over 99% of attacks target login credentials.
2. Train Your People (Your Biggest Risk & Defence)
✔ Teach staff how to spot phishing emails
✔ Run simple awareness sessions (15–30 mins quarterly)
✔ Encourage a “pause before clicking” mindset
Red flags to watch for:
Urgent payment requests
Unexpected attachments
“Reset your password” emails
3. Secure Your Cloud Systems

✔ Review who has access to what
✔ Remove old or inactive user accounts
✔ Limit admin access to only 1–2 trusted people
Common mistake:
Everyone has access to everything.
4. Back Up Your Data Properly
✔ Use automatic backups
✔ Store backups offline or in a separate system
✔ Test recovery at least twice a year
Rule:
If you haven’t tested it, don’t trust it.
5. Keep Systems Updated
✔ Turn on automatic updates
✔ Patch operating systems and software
✔ Update routers, firewalls, and devices
Most attacks exploit known vulnerabilities.
6. Monitor for Unusual Activity

✔ Watch for login alerts from unusual locations
✔ Review email forwarding rules
✔ Check for unknown devices accessing systems
7. Have a Simple Response Plan
✔ Who do you call if something goes wrong?
✔ How do you isolate affected systems?
✔ Where are your backups?
Even a 1-page plan is better than none.
